COVID-19 cases have continued to rise across Oxfordshire and the rest of the UK.
According to Public Health England the latest number of cases since 4.30pm yesterday has been confirmed as 6,106 in the county.
This is up by 160 and the breakdown of the number by local authority is:
- Oxford - 1,942
- Cherwell - 1,299
- South Oxfordshire - 1053
- Vale of White Horse - 934
- West Oxfordshire - 878

A further 174 people had died within 28 days of testing positive for Covid-19 as of Saturday.
This brings the UK total to 44,745.
Separate figures published by the UK’s statistics agencies show there have now been 59,000 deaths registered in the UK where Covid-19 was mentioned on the death certificate.
As of 9am on Saturday, there had been a further 23,012 lab-confirmed cases of coronavirus in the UK.
It brings the total number of cases in the UK to 854,010.
